Posted in

Cloud Computing: Transforming How We Store and Access Data

Cloud Computing

Understanding Cloud Computing

Have you ever wondered how businesses manage to store vast amounts of data without breaking the bank? The answer lies in Cloud Computing. This technology has revolutionized the way we think about data storage, accessibility, and computing power. Instead of relying solely on physical servers, cloud computing allows businesses and individuals to use the internet to access resources, applications, and services. It’s a shift from traditional methods, paving the way for a more flexible and scalable approach to computing.

At its core, cloud computing offers a range of services, including data storage, processing power, and software applications, all accessible via the internet. This model not only reduces costs associated with maintaining physical servers but also enhances collaboration. Employees can access the same files and applications from anywhere in the world, as long as they have an internet connection. This accessibility is crucial for businesses operating in the global economy, where remote work is becoming increasingly common.

Types of Cloud Computing

When diving into Cloud Computing, you’ll encounter three primary models: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S). Each serves different purposes and is tailored to meet varying business needs.

IaaS provides virtualized computing resources over the internet. Think of it as renting servers instead of buying them. Companies like Amazon Web Services (AWS) and Microsoft Azure offer IaaS, allowing businesses to scale their infrastructure based on demand.

On the flip side, PaaS offers a platform allowing developers to build, deploy, and manage applications without worrying about the underlying infrastructure. This model is particularly beneficial for businesses looking to streamline app development while focusing on coding rather than infrastructure management.

See also  Mastering Cloud Cost Optimization (FinOps) Strategies

Finally, SaaS delivers software applications over the internet on a subscription basis. Popular examples include Google Workspace and Salesforce. With SaaS, users can access the latest software without the need for installations or updates, making it a convenient option for many businesses.

Benefits of Cloud Computing

Cloud computing comes with a plethora of advantages that can significantly impact your business operations. One of the most notable benefits is cost efficiency. By utilizing cloud services, companies can reduce expenses related to maintaining physical hardware and software. This means lower IT costs and the ability to allocate resources to other crucial areas of your business.

Another compelling benefit is the scalability that cloud computing offers. Businesses can quickly scale their resources up or down based on their current needs. This flexibility is especially beneficial for companies experiencing fluctuations in demand or those looking to expand their operations. Understanding Platform Engineering: A Comprehensive Guide

Moreover, cloud computing enhances collaboration among team members. With cloud-based tools, employees can work together in real time, regardless of their physical location. This is particularly crucial in today’s remote work environment, where teams may be spread across different time zones.

Security in Cloud Computing

One of the primary concerns businesses have about Cloud Computing is security. It’s vital to understand that while cloud providers invest heavily in security measures, vulnerabilities can still exist. Therefore, it’s essential to choose a reputable provider that offers robust security protocols.

Many cloud platforms provide encryption both at rest and in transit, ensuring that your data remains protected from unauthorized access. Additionally, implementing multi-factor authentication can add an extra layer of security, making it harder for cybercriminals to gain access to sensitive information.

See also  Top Enterprise Resource Planning Solutions for Your Business
Cloud Computing

It’s also crucial for businesses to regularly back up their data and have a disaster recovery plan in place. This ensures that even in the event of a security breach, your data remains safe and can be quickly restored.

Common Misconceptions about Cloud Computing

Despite its many advantages, several misconceptions about Cloud Computing persist. One common belief is that cloud computing is inherently insecure. While security risks do exist, many cloud providers implement stringent security measures that often exceed those of traditional on-premise systems.

Another misconception is that cloud services are only suitable for larger enterprises. In reality, businesses of all sizes can benefit from cloud computing. Small businesses, in particular, can leverage cloud solutions to access enterprise-level technology without the hefty price tag associated with on-premise systems.

Lastly, some believe that migrating to the cloud is overly complicated. While it can be a significant transition, with proper planning and a clear strategy, businesses can achieve a smooth migration process. AI Security Platforms: Safeguarding Your Digital Future

Future of Cloud Computing

The future of Cloud Computing looks promising as it continues to evolve. Trends indicate a shift towards more hybrid cloud solutions, where businesses utilize both public and private clouds to optimize their resources. This approach allows organizations to maintain control over sensitive data while still benefiting from the scalability of public cloud services.

Additionally, advancements in artificial intelligence and machine learning are being integrated into cloud services, enhancing their capabilities and making them more efficient. As cloud technology progresses, it’s likely that businesses will find even more innovative ways to utilize these resources to drive growth and improve operations.

See also  Understanding Platform Engineering: A Comprehensive Guide

FAQs

What is cloud computing?
Cloud computing refers to the delivery of computing services over the internet, including storage, processing, and software applications.

What are the main types of cloud computing?
The three main types are IaaS, PaaS, and SaaS, each serving different needs for businesses.

Is cloud computing secure?
While security risks exist, reputable cloud providers implement strong security measures to protect data.

Can small businesses use cloud computing?
Yes, cloud computing is beneficial for businesses of all sizes, including small enterprises.

What is the future of cloud computing?
The future includes hybrid solutions and increased integration of AI and machine learning technologies.